Output e33e26bc1ec9c3cb0d3c01c628b666379a39c3db78a38b2a8d64de9605bae64e:13

value
3809
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2fbf2736608bde14c818f0a2f22a7acf76fa650a766e54b6679ff24c9825939
address
bc1putalyumxpz77znyp3u9z7g484nmklfjs5anw2jmx08ljfjvztyussuvp76
transaction
e33e26bc1ec9c3cb0d3c01c628b666379a39c3db78a38b2a8d64de9605bae64e
spent
true